Output 23e687f94212a75c06cb2d7be924773a0b98419f572ad26c3f85c60ff7b6bd76:0

value
73388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ade4a225ce53595efca441ba3bdcaa03cbb36d71 OP_EQUAL
address
3HYUiTSwuDGtzaAJAjwcw6YTdfoqe1HAeg
transaction
23e687f94212a75c06cb2d7be924773a0b98419f572ad26c3f85c60ff7b6bd76
spent
true